Transaction 43f4d5f608d121a2d77d95de6de0b9d049b32a6dd8e5bd104ec0ee79bf0d4aea
1 Input
1 Output
-
43f4d5f608d121a2d77d95de6de0b9d049b32a6dd8e5bd104ec0ee79bf0d4aea:0
- value
- 845993
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 03b95912da437bd7625edaadc550cd831157bc2d OP_EQUAL
- address
- 322hzKXGRUdkTrAuYkHRLB2QcWaopLaPoQ